Match facts and stats: Europa League MD 6

  • Sevilla have won 19 of their last 23 matches
  • Arsenal have won their last 3 matches against Standard Liege in all competitions - and will be through to the next round with a win or draw, or if Frankfurt lose
  • Wolfsberger AC have failed to score in 5 of their last 7 matches
  • Wolves are undefeated in 10 of their last 11 matches
  • Sporting have kept a clean sheet in their last 3 matches
